PUBLIC AUCTION

  FRIDAY   19 MAY 2023   4:00 P.M.

 

                 LOCATION:CROSSROADS MARKET & AUCTION, 5415 ROUTE 25, LYKENS

(BETWEEN GRATZ & BERRYSBURG ALONG ROUTE 25)

 

ANTIQUES & COLLECTIBLES

Wexford  14-pc. Entertainment Service, IOB; Pyrex; Crocks; Beer Trays; PA & NJ License Plates;  “J.E. Rebuck Sign”; Lanterns; Black Velvet Paintings; Bachmann Train Set; Collector’s Dolls; Red Vinyl Barbie Case; Longaberger Baskets, Cookie Molds, Star Dish & Plush Bear; Millersburg Collectibles; Sports Cards; Boyd’s Plush; Department 56 Snow Babies; Willow Tree Angels; Collection of Snowmen & Signs; NASCAR Collectibles; Dallas Cowboys & Steelers Collectibles; Coca Cola Collectibles; Ertl Knoebel’s Grove 1931 Hawkeye Die-Cast Vehicle Bank; Hess Trucks; Motorized Ferris Wheel Erector Set; Horse Collar; Pr. Hames; TV Trays; Window Sashes; Wooden Ironing Board; Brass Torch; Snow Eagles; Sad Irons; Egg Baskets; Jump Traps; Tractor Seat; Etc.

 

Collection of Local Historical Books:  Bicentennial Books (Klingerstown, Millersburg, Elizabethville, Dalmatia & Berrysburg/Mifflin Township); Halifax 175th Celebration; Historical Book of Berrysburg & Mifflin Township; Elizabethville Sesquicentennial; Gratz 175th Celebration; A Complete History of the Town of Gratz; History of Pillow; Vera Cruz-Malta 150yrs; Pennsylvania Beautiful by Wallace Nutting; There’s Something About Rough & Ready; Klingerstown Reflections of Yesterday & Reproduction Issue of Lykens Williams Valley Bicentennial.

 

HOUSEHOLD, TOOLS & RELATED ITEMS

Amana Refrigerator/Freezer; Deacon’s Bench w/Heart Cutout Back; Asst. Wooden Benches; Computer Desk w/Chair; (3) Twin Bed Frames; Frame for Trundle Bed; Night Stand; Media Storage Cabinet; Hampers; Bookshelf; 6’ Folding Table; Metal Filing Cabinets; Storage Chest; Luggage; Weider 400 Weight Bench w/Weights; AB Lounger; 40# Cast Iron Dumbbell Set; Graco Infant Furnishings (Pack N Play, Motion activated seat, etc.); Mongoose Rebel Bike; Galileo Telescope; Asst. Electronics; CD’s; PlayStation Games; Bella Juice Extractor; Assorted Small Household Appliances; Revere Ware Stock Pot; Cookware; Bakeware; Utensils; Flatware; Pampered Chef Kitchen Items; Cookbooks; Kitchen Linens; Tablecloths & Placemats; Doilies; Throws; Afghans; Sheets; (6) 4-8# packages of E-Z Que Bar-B-Que Charcoal Briquettes; Styrofoam Cups, Plates & Bowls; Napkins; Toilet Paper; Paper Towels; Tissues; Hardback & Paperback Novels; Puzzles; Christmas Decorations (55” 3-D Lighted Sleigh, Small Trees, Wreathes, Garland, Lights, Ornaments, etc.); Halloween & Easter Decorations; Table-Top Aquarium; Movie Screen; Hand Tools; Bench Vise; Fishing Rods; Rolling Garden Cart; Planters; Carpet Remnants; Max AP Canopy (10’x 20’) only used once; 7’x 5’ Trail Tent;Craftsman Eager-1 Edger; Poulon Pro Blower; Assorted Box Lots; Etc.

 

ORDER OF SALE:  Tonight’s auction will begin at 4:00 P.M.  Bidder registration and auction inspection begins at 3:30 P.M. Furniture and items displayed on the main floor will be sold starting at approximately 6:30 P.M.  As in previous weeks, we will sell until all items are sold!

 

TERMS:  CASH.  Personal Checks Accepted w/Established Account Or Prior Approval. Credit Cards or Debit Cards Not Accepted.  No Buyer’s Premium.  All items

displayed will be sold to the highest bidder.  All items are sold “as is, where is”.   

All Items Are Subject To 6% PA Sales Tax.    

 

 No Absentee, Phone Bids or On-Line Bidding Accepted.
